Harry William Minard, 74, of North Aurora, passed away Wednesday June 7, 2017 at Presence Mercy Medical Center in Aurora, IL.  Harry was born December 11, 1942, son of Harry L. and Marion (Berger). He proudly served in the United States Marine Corp during the Vietnam War.  Harry was employed at Lyon Metal in Aurora, where he was a mechanic for over 35 years.  Harry’s favorite hobby was fishing; whether it was fresh water or salt water; you would always find a rod and reel in his hand. Harry took an early retirement, then enjoyed helping others and working on small engines. He was also an avid Chicago Bears fan; even if the score was 35-0 he would say, “They still have a chance”!  He was also a friend and mentor of Bill W. for 41 years and at that time of his life, he chose to become a humble servant  serving God and others.  Harry is survived by his wife of 35 years; Kay, 4 daughters, Faith Ann (Jake) Does, Sherry Rae (David) Breese, Deanna Lee Minard, and Jani Jo Lee (Finance’ Glen Anderson).  9 Grandchildren; Larry Franklin, Carly Rae Brown,  David Bester, Richard Bester, William (Bianca) Bester, Myles Negron, Paul Garza, Rachel Messacar and Michael Messacar. 5 great  grandchildren; Grace Bester, Cheyenne Bester, Charleigh Bester, Sofia Bester and Aidalyz Negron.  Harry is preceded in death by his parents, 2 sisters, Carol Gale, Joy Channel, and 2 twin grandsons, Zachery and Jeremy Brown.
